Output 40aebe368925b7d02dde990b81339b21e1f1f436cea95e53f5ec509a6175f900:5

value
2041400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44d7aa16adace39abc6d4cc33d0ca6100ccbceff OP_EQUALVERIFY OP_CHECKSIG
address
17H1JfsoBrzeeGS5xKyHqoodNYAa4gdFjy
transaction
40aebe368925b7d02dde990b81339b21e1f1f436cea95e53f5ec509a6175f900
spent
true